在区块链的世界里,代币发行项目层出不穷,而选择一个合适的底层平台对于项目的成功至关重要,以太坊(Ethereum)和EOS作为两大主流的公链平台,各有其独特的优势和生态特点,常常成为项目方在代币发行时的首选对比对象,究竟是以太坊还是EOS更适合进行代币发行呢?本文将从多个维度进行深入剖析,帮助您做出更明智的选择。

以太坊:智能合约的鼻祖,成熟与生态的代名词

以太坊作为第一个支持智能合约的公有区块链平台,自诞生以来便奠定了其在区块链领域的领先地位,其代币发行(通常基于ERC-20标准)经历多年的发展,已成为行业事实上的标准之一。

优势:

  1. 极高的安全性与稳定性:以太坊网络运行多年,经历了多次市场考验和智能合约漏洞的洗礼(如The DAO事件后进行了硬分叉),其底层协议和Solidity智能合约语言相对成熟,拥有庞大的开发者社区和丰富的审计资源,能够大大降低智能合约的安全风险。
  2. 庞大的生态系统与流动性:以太坊拥有最庞大的DApp生态、最广泛的交易所支持和最高的市场流动性,代币在以太坊上发行后,更容易被投资者接受、交易和集成到各种DeFi协议中。
  3. 强大的开发者社区与工具支持:作为开发者的首选平台之一,以太坊拥有海量的学习资源、开发工具、框架和库(如Truffle, Hardhat, Web3.js等),使得开发者可以更高效地进行智能合约的开发、测试和部署。
  4. 广泛的兼容性与互操作性:基于ERC-20标准的代币几乎可以无缝集成到所有支持以太坊生态的钱包、交易所和DApp中,极大地提升了代币的可用性和流通性。
  5. 去中心化程度高:以太坊采用PoW(工作量证明,正逐步过渡到PoS)共识机制,节点分布广泛,去中心化程度相对较高,符合区块链的核心理念,更容易获得社区的信任。

劣势:

  1. 网络拥堵与高Gas费:由于以太坊网络上的交易需求巨大,经常出现网络拥堵,导致Gas费飙升,这对于小额支付或高频交易的代币项目来说,是一个不小的负担。
  2. 交易速度相对较慢:以太坊的出块时间约为13-15秒,交易确认时间在拥堵时会更长,这限制了需要高吞吐量的应用场景。
  3. 可扩展性挑战:虽然以太坊正在通过分片(Sharding)等技术(如以太坊2.0)来解决可扩展性问题,但目前其TPS(每秒交易处理量)仍然有限。

EOS:高性能的挑战者,速度与资源的平衡者

EOS旨在以太坊的基础上进行改进,主打高性能、低费用和更好的用户体验,它采用DPoS(委托权益证明)共识机制,由21个超级节点负责出块,理论上能够实现更高的TPS。

优势:

  1. 高吞吐量与低延迟:EOS的设计目标是支持每秒数千笔交易(TPS),并且交易确认速度快,网络拥堵和高Gas费问题在以太坊上较为突出,而在EOS上则得到了极大改善。
  2. 低廉的交易成本:EOS用户在进行交易时,主要是通过持有和抵押EOS代币来获取网络资源(CPU和NET),而非直接支付Gas费,对于代币持有者而言,日常操作成本极低。
  3. 用户友好的体验:EOS提供了更接近Web2.0的用户体验,账户名易于记忆,无需复杂的私钥管理(可通过钱包应用简化),更适合普通用户。
  4. 内置的资源管理模型:EOS的CPU和NET资源模型使得用户可以根据自身需求租赁或抵押资源,避免了因Gas费波动导致的服务中断。
  5. 强调开发者友好:EOS提供了C 和WebAssembly等多种开发语言支持,以及更完善的开发工具和文档,旨在降低开发门槛。

劣势:

  1. 去中心化程度相对较低:DPoS共识机制依赖于21个超级节点,虽然选举机制引入了一定程度的去中心化,但相比以太坊的全球节点网络,其去中心化程度受到一些争议。
  2. 生态成熟度与流动性不如以太坊:尽管EOS生态也在发展,但整体DApp数量、用户规模和市场流动性与以太坊相比仍有较大差距,代币的接受度和流通性相对较弱。
  3. 社区治理与争议:EOS的治理机制和超级节点的运作方式有时会引发社区争议,可能影响项目的稳定性和发展。
  4. 资源模型的复杂性:对于新用户而言,EOS的CPU、NET和RAM资源模型可能需要一定的学习成本,理解其运作方式。

如何选择?关键看项目需求

没有绝对“好”或“坏”的平台,只有“适合”或“不适合”,选择以太坊还是EOS进行代币发行,主要取决于项目的具体需求和定位:

  1. 如果项目追求最高安全性和去中心化,且对交易成本和速度不是极端敏感

    • 例如:需要广泛接受、长期持有、参与复杂DeFi协议的治理型代币、价值存储型代币。
    • 选择以太坊,其成熟的安全性和庞大的生态是无法替代的优势。
  2. 如果项目是高频交易、游戏、社交类DApp,对TPS和交易成本有较高要求

    • 例如:需要处理大量小额支付、实时交互的代币经济模型。
    • 选择EOS,其高性能和低费用能更好地支撑这类应用的运行。
  3. 如果项目希望快速启动并利用成熟的开发工具和社区资源

    • 选择以太坊,其成熟的开发者生态和丰富的第三方工具能大大缩短开发周期。
  4. 如果项目更注重用户体验,希望降低用户使用门槛

    • 选择EOS,其更友好的账户模型和低操作成本对普通用户更友好。

以太坊和EOS在代币发行领域各有千秋,以太坊凭借其先发优势、强大的安全性和成熟的生态,依然是许多追求稳健和广泛接受度的项目的首选,而EOS则以其高性能、低费用和良好的用户体验,在特定应用场景下展现出独特的吸引力。

项目方需要根据自身的代币经济模型、目标用户群体、技术能力以及对去中心化程度的权衡,进行综合考量,甚至,有些项目会考虑在多链上发行,以兼顾不同平台的优势,无论选择哪个平台,深入理解其技术特性、生态现状以及潜在风险,都是确保代币发行成功的关键一步,区块链世界发展迅速,未来也可能出现更多优秀的平台,但以太坊和EOS在可预见的未来,仍将是代币发行领域的重要力量。